Changeset 100171 in vbox for trunk/src/VBox/Runtime/r3/win
- Timestamp:
- Jun 13, 2023 9:07:56 PM (20 months ago)
- Location:
- trunk/src/VBox/Runtime/r3/win
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/VBox/Runtime/r3/win/init-win.cpp
r98103 r100171 136 136 /** WSASend */ 137 137 DECL_HIDDEN_DATA(PFNWSASEND) g_pfnWSASend = NULL; 138 /** WSAIoctl */ 139 DECL_HIDDEN_DATA(PFNWSAIOCTL) g_pfnWSAIoctl = NULL; 138 140 /** socket */ 139 141 DECL_HIDDEN_DATA(PFNWINSOCKSOCKET) g_pfnsocket = NULL; … … 447 449 g_pfnWSASocketW = (decltype(g_pfnWSASocketW)) GetProcAddress(g_hModWinSock, "WSASocketW"); 448 450 g_pfnWSASend = (decltype(g_pfnWSASend)) GetProcAddress(g_hModWinSock, "WSASend"); 451 g_pfnWSAIoctl = (decltype(g_pfnWSAIoctl)) GetProcAddress(g_hModWinSock, "WSAIoctl"); 449 452 g_pfnsocket = (decltype(g_pfnsocket)) GetProcAddress(g_hModWinSock, "socket"); 450 453 g_pfnclosesocket = (decltype(g_pfnclosesocket)) GetProcAddress(g_hModWinSock, "closesocket"); … … 478 481 Assert(g_pfnWSASocketW || g_fOldWinSock); 479 482 Assert(g_pfnWSASend || g_fOldWinSock); 483 Assert(g_pfnWSAIoctl || g_fOldWinSock); 480 484 Assert(g_pfnsocket); 481 485 Assert(g_pfnclosesocket); -
trunk/src/VBox/Runtime/r3/win/internal-r3-win.h
r98103 r100171 167 167 /** WSASend */ 168 168 typedef int (WINAPI *PFNWSASEND)(UINT_PTR, struct _WSABUF *, DWORD, LPDWORD, DWORD dwFlags, 169 struct _OVERLAPPED *, uintptr_t /*LPWSAOVERLAPPED_COMPLETION_ROUTINE*/); 170 /** WSAIoctl */ 171 typedef int (WINAPI *PFNWSAIOCTL)(UINT_PTR, DWORD, LPVOID, DWORD, LPVOID, DWORD, LPDWORD, 169 172 struct _OVERLAPPED *, uintptr_t /*LPWSAOVERLAPPED_COMPLETION_ROUTINE*/); 170 173 … … 219 222 extern DECL_HIDDEN_DATA(PFNWSASOCKETW) g_pfnWSASocketW; 220 223 extern DECL_HIDDEN_DATA(PFNWSASEND) g_pfnWSASend; 224 extern DECL_HIDDEN_DATA(PFNWSAIOCTL) g_pfnWSAIoctl; 221 225 extern DECL_HIDDEN_DATA(PFNWINSOCKSOCKET) g_pfnsocket; 222 226 extern DECL_HIDDEN_DATA(PFNWINSOCKCLOSESOCKET) g_pfnclosesocket;
Note:
See TracChangeset
for help on using the changeset viewer.